How to insure reliable signal transmission in high speed operation

Nowadays, slip rings are used in many different applications widely in this modern industry automation process, which solves various signal and current transmission between rotating part and fixed part of mechanical joint. Usually, the metal ring and the surface of brush wire need to do high quality plating surface handling, also most of covering layer is precious metal which primarily meet good conduction, wear-resistant, corrosion resistant performance of slip ring.

Slip ring is mostly used in civilian field, many of them are high technology and high demand applications, this kind of slip ring should always work continuously under high temperature, shock, high speed rotation conditions and so on. In such case, slipring should satisfy with high performance demand, also supplier must take advantage of test result to prove reliable operation of slip ring in special environment. For example, you can make different test under various temperature and working speed for slip ring, then the difference of temperature and working speed could lead to voltage signal and noise change. Through the test proof that the increasing of working speed and temperature will be result in greater voltage signal noise in vacuum condition . Even if temperature could be from -20℃--+80℃ and working speed rise to 1.2m/s, the SNR is still greater than 278/1, herewith we can arrive at a conclusion that, the temperature and working speed of slip ring do not has much impact to electrical signal transmission, they basically can be applied in the same environment.
